You are on page 1of 24

05

Implementing Expenditures

Copyright 2010, Oracle. All rights reserved.

Objectives

After completing this lesson, you should be able to do the


following:
Identify the expenditure type classes available in Oracle
Project Costing
Define setup steps related to expenditures

5-2

Copyright 2010, Oracle. All rights reserved.

Expenditures Implementation Steps


Step

Required?

Setup Level

Define expenditure categories


Define revenue categories
Define units
Define expenditure types
Implement transaction control extension
Implement autoapproval extension
Define transaction sources

Yes
Yes
Yes
Yes
No
No
No

Site
Site
Site
Site
Site
Site
Site

Expenditures Implementation Steps

5-3

Copyright 2010, Oracle. All rights reserved.

Agenda

5-4

Expenditure Definition
Processing Extensions
Transaction Sources
Listings

Copyright 2010, Oracle. All rights reserved.

Expenditure Categories

Example:
Expenditure Category

Expenditure Type

Labor

Professional

Clerical

Each expenditure type is assigned a single


expenditure category.

5-5

Copyright 2010, Oracle. All rights reserved.

Define Revenue Categories

Revenue Category

Example:
Labor Revenue

Expenditure Types
Event Types

Professional

Clerical

Each expenditure type and each event type


is assigned a single revenue category.

5-6

Copyright 2010, Oracle. All rights reserved.

Define Units

Oracle Project Costing


predefines the units Currency
and Hours

5-7

You can define other units,


such as Kilometers or Cases

Copyright 2010, Oracle. All rights reserved.

Expenditure Type Classes

Straight Time

Inventory

Overtime

Work In Process

Expense Reports

Supplier Invoices
Burden Transaction

5-8

Oracle
Project
Costing

Usages
Miscellaneous
Transactions

Copyright 2010, Oracle. All rights reserved.

Define Expenditure Types

Expenditure Category: Labor


Revenue Category: Labor
Expenditure Type: Clerical

Expenditure Category:
Expenses
Revenue Category: Other
Expenditure Types: Airfare

5-9

Copyright 2010, Oracle. All rights reserved.

Multiple Expenditure Type Classes Per


Expenditure Type

Supplier Invoice
Materials
Inventory
Expenditure Type

Expenditure Type Classes

Use the same expenditure type for


multiple classes of transactions.

5 - 10

Copyright 2010, Oracle. All rights reserved.

Quiz
Oracle Project Costing uses expenditure categories to group
___ for costing.
a. expenditure batch
b. expenditure types
c. revenue type
d. transaction sources

5 - 11

Copyright 2010, Oracle. All rights reserved.

Quiz
Which of the following is not an expenditure type class?
a. Inventory
b. Work In Process
c. Purchase Order
d. Expense Reports

5 - 12

Copyright 2010, Oracle. All rights reserved.

Agenda

5 - 13

Expenditure Definition
Processing Extensions
Transaction Sources
Listings

Copyright 2010, Oracle. All rights reserved.

Transaction Control Extension

Validate
Transaction

Validate expenditure item date against


project and task transaction dates
Validate that the project status allows
new transactions
Validate that the task is chargeable

Standard
Validation

Validate transaction controls at task


and project levels
Call the transaction control extension

The transaction control extension is called during expenditure entry


and during transaction import.
5 - 14

Copyright 2010, Oracle. All rights reserved.

Quiz
The program PRC: Transaction Import calls the transaction
control extension, to validate transactions, before they are
loaded into Oracle Project Costing.
a. True
b. False

5 - 15

Copyright 2010, Oracle. All rights reserved.

AutoApproval Extension

Forward to
Approver

AutoApproval
Extension

For example,
submit a
timecard

5 - 16

Approve
timecard

Copyright 2010, Oracle. All rights reserved.

Agenda

5 - 17

Expenditure Definition
Processing Extensions
Transaction Sources
Listings

Copyright 2010, Oracle. All rights reserved.

Define Transaction Sources

Populate
Transaction
Interface
Table

Run PRC:
Transaction
Import
Transaction
Interface Table

Expenditure Tables

Specify the transaction source when you import


transactions into Oracle Project Costing.

5 - 18

Copyright 2010, Oracle. All rights reserved.

Example Predefined Transaction Sources


Transaction Source

Used to import

Oracle Payables
Expense Reports

Expense reports from Oracle Payables

Oracle Payables
Invoice Variance

Invoice price and tax variance amounts from


Oracle Payables

Oracle Purchasing
Receipt Accruals

Receipt accruals from Oracle Purchasing

CSE_PO_RECEIPT

Transactions of the type Receipt for nondepreciable items from Oracle Asset Tracking

Oracle Time and Labor

Timecards from Oracle Time & Labor

Project Allocations

Project allocations generated in Oracle Project


Costing

5 - 19

Copyright 2010, Oracle. All rights reserved.

Example Predefined Transaction Sources:


Manufacturing and Inventory
Transaction Source

Used to import

WIP with Accounts

Manufacturing nonlabor resource costs with


account information that Oracle Project Costing
categorizes as work in process

WIP Straight Time with


Accounts

Manufacturing labor resource costs with account


information that Oracle Projects categorizes as
straight time

Inventory with No
Accounts

Manufacturing material costs for which Oracle


Projects uses AutoAccounting to derive accounts
and creates accounting in Oracle Subledger
Accounting

5 - 20

Copyright 2010, Oracle. All rights reserved.

Quiz
The Oracle WIP with Accounts transaction source is used to
import manufacturing non labor resource costs with account
information that Oracle Project Costing categorizes as work in
process.
a. True
b. False

5 - 21

Copyright 2010, Oracle. All rights reserved.

Agenda

5 - 22

Expenditure Definition
Processing Extensions
Transaction Sources
Listings

Copyright 2010, Oracle. All rights reserved.

Listings

5 - 23

IMP: Expenditure Types Definition


IMP: Revenue Categories
IMP: Units Definition

Copyright 2010, Oracle. All rights reserved.

Summary
In this lesson, you should have learned how to:
Explain the purpose of each expenditure type class
Identify the setup steps required to implement expenditures

5 - 24

Copyright 2010, Oracle. All rights reserved.

You might also like